View moreThe Defense Logistics Agency, through the DLA Aviation office, is issuing a combined synopsis/solicitation for the procurement of optical instrument cases under NSN 5855016864785. This requirement, identified by solicitation number SPE4A726U0072, is categorized under NAICS code 334511 for Search, Detection, Navigation, Guidance, Aeronautical, and Nautical System and Instrument Manufacturing and PSC code 58. The solicitation is for a quantity of 57 units, with an approved source specified as 13567 285928-1.
The government intends to establish an Automated Indefinite Delivery Contract (IDC) with a performance period of one year or until orders reach a total value of $250,000.00. The contract anticipates an estimated three orders per year with a guaranteed minimum quantity of eight units. Deliveries are required within 66 days after date of order and will be shipped to various CONUS and OCONUS DLA Depots.
Interested parties must submit quotes electronically by the response deadline of June 23, 2026. This Request for Quotation (RFQ) is open to all responsible sources, though specifications, plans, and drawings are not available for this notice. The solicitation is accessible through the DLA Internet Bid Board System (DIBBS), as hard copies will not be provided.
